Mediterranean Chicken Soup

This Mediterranean chicken soup is a light and hearty dish that’s perfect for any occasion. Bursting with flavors from herbs and spices, it offers a delightful twist on traditional chicken soup. The combination of tender chicken, fresh vegetables, and savory broth makes it both comforting and refreshing.
What sets this soup apart is its simple preparation. With just a handful of ingredients, you can whip up a nutritious meal that’s ideal for busy weeknights or a cozy weekend lunch. It’s a dish that warms the soul and pleases the palate!
Ingredients
- 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 1 can diced tomatoes (14.5 oz)
- 1 cup spinach, chopped
- 1/2 cup kalamata olives, pitted and sliced
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Feta cheese for garnish (optional)
Instructions
- In a large pot, combine the chicken broth, diced tomatoes, oregano, thyme, garlic powder, and season with salt and pepper. Bring to a boil.
- Add the chicken breasts to the pot and simmer for about 20 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.
- Remove the chicken, shred it using two forks, and return it to the pot.
- Stir in the chopped spinach and sliced olives, allowing them to wilt for about 5 minutes.
- Serve hot, garnished with crumbled feta cheese if desired.
Hearty Chicken Noodle Soup

This hearty chicken noodle soup is a comforting classic that warms you up from the inside out. With tender chicken, vibrant vegetables, and delightful egg noodles, it’s a perfect dish for any occasion, especially on chilly days.
Making this soup is simple and straightforward, perfect for both experienced cooks and beginners. Just gather your ingredients, and you’ll have a delicious pot of soup simmering on the stove in no time!
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 carrots, sliced
- 2 celery stalks, sliced
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ried parsley
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 2 cups egg noodles
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add onion and garlic, sautéing until the onion becomes translucent.
- Stir in carrots, celery, thyme, and parsley. Cook for about 5 minutes until the vegetables begin to soften.
- Add the chicken bro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at, and let it simmer for about 10 minutes.
- Stir in the cooked chicken and egg noodles. Continue to cook until the noodles are tender, about 6-8 minutes.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.
Spicy Thai Chicken Soup

Spicy Thai Chicken Soup is a delicious dish that brings warmth and excitement to your meal. This soup boasts vibrant flavors and a comforting spicy kick that makes it a favorite for many. It’s not just tasty; it’s also simple to prepare, making it perfect for a weeknight dinner or a cozy gathering with friends.
The combination of tender chicken, aromatic spices, and fresh herbs creates a delightful experience in every spoonful. You’ll enjoy the balance of heat and freshness, along with a hint of tanginess from lime. This soup is sure to brighten your day!
Ingredients
- 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ken thighs
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 can (14 oz) coconut milk
- 2 tablespoons red curry paste
- 1 tablespoon fish sauce
- 2 tablespoons lime juice
- 1 stalk lemongrass, sliced
- 2-3 kaffir lime leaves
- 1 cup mushrooms, sliced
- 1-2 Thai bird chilies, sliced (adjust for heat)
- Fresh cilantro, for garnish
- Lime wedges, for serving
Instructions
- In a large pot, bring chicken broth to a boil. Add the chicken thighs and cook until fully cooked, about 10-15 minutes. Remove the chicken, shred it, and set aside.
- Add coconut milk, red curry paste, fish sauce, lime juice, lemongrass, and kaffir lime leaves to the broth. Stir well and bring to a simmer.
- Add sliced mushrooms and chilies to the pot. Let it simmer for about 5 minutes until the mushrooms are tender.
- Return the shredded chicken to the pot and stir to combine.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ro and lime wedges on the side.
Classic Comfort Chicken Soup

Nothing beats a warm bowl of classic chicken soup on a chilly day. It’s the ultimate comfort food, offering a rich, savory flavor that soothes the soul. With tender chunks of chicken, fresh veggies, and aromatic herbs, this soup is both hearty and satisfying. Plus, it’s simple to whip up, making it perfect for a cozy family dinner or a quick weeknight meal.
Each spoonful brings a delightful blend of textures and tastes, making it a timeless favorite for everyone. Whether you’re sick, cold, or just in need of a comforting meal, this recipe is sure to warm you right up!
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, sliced
- 2 celery stalks, sliced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ups shredded cooked chicken
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 bay leaf
- 1 cup egg noodles (optional)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onion, carrots, and celery; sauté until the vegetables are tender, about 5 minutes.
-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.
- Add the chicken broth, shredded chicken, thyme, and bay leaf.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and let simmer for 20 minutes.
- If using, add the egg noodles and cook according to package instructions until al dente.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ste. Remove the bay leaf before serving. Garnish with fresh parsley and enjoy!
Creamy Chicken and Rice Soup

Creamy Chicken and Rice Soup is a comforting dish that warms both the body and the soul. With tender pieces of chicken, hearty rice, and a rich, creamy broth, this soup is a delightful meal that can be made in just one pot. It’s simple to prepare and perfect for chilly days or whenever you need a little extra comfort.
The flavors meld beautifully, creating a balance of savory and creamy that will have everyone asking for seconds. Plus, it’s easy to customize with your favorite vegetables or spices, making it a versatile choice for any occasion.
Ingredients
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 cup rice (white or brown)
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at a bit of oil over medium heat. Add the onion, carrots, and celery. Sauté until they are softened, about 5-7 minutes.
- Add the gar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.
- Stir in the rice and chicken broth, bringing it to a boil. Reduce heat to a simmer and cook until the rice is tender, about 15-20 minutes.
- Add the shredded chicken, heavy cream, thyme, salt, and pepper. Stir well and let simmer for an additional 5 minutes.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.
Southwestern Chicken Tortilla Soup

This Southwestern Chicken Tortilla Soup is a hearty blend of flavors that will warm you up from the inside out. With its spicy kick and comforting ingredients, it’s a delightful dish that’s perfect for any day of the week. Plus, it’s quite simple to make, making it an excellent option for both busy weeknights and cozy weekends.
This soup features tender chicken, fresh vegetables, and crunchy tortilla strips topped with creamy avocado. The vibrant colors and zesty flavors come together for a delicious meal that’s sure to please everyone at the table.
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 bell pepper, diced
- 1 can (15 oz) diced tomatoes
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 cup corn kernels (fresh or frozen)
- 1 tablespoon chili powder
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 avocados, sliced
- 1 cup tortilla strips
- Fresh cilantro for garnish
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and garlic, cooking until the onion is translucent.
- Stir in the bell pepper, diced tomatoes, chicken broth, shredded chicken, black beans, corn, chili powder, cumin,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and let simmer for 20 minutes.
- Just before serving, stir in fresh cilantro and adjust seasoning if needed.
- Serve hot, topped with sliced avocado and crispy tortilla strips for added crunch.
Slow Cooker Chicken and Dumplings

Slow Cooker Chicken and Dumplings is a comforting dish that brings warmth and satisfaction with every bite. It features tender chicken simmered in a flavorful broth, accompanied by fluffy dumplings that soak up all the deliciousness. This recipe is not only mouthwatering but also incredibly simple to prepare, making it a go-to for busy weeknights or cozy weekends.
The magic happens in your slow cooker, where the chicken becomes tender and juicy while the dumplings cook to perfection. It’s a delightful blend of flavors and textures that will remind you of home-cooked meals. Serve it warm, and enjoy the cozy vibes it brings!
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 1 cup chopped carrots
- 1 cup chopped celery
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
- 1 cup milk
- 2 cups biscuit mix
- 2/3 cup milk (for dumplings)
Instructions
- Place the chicken breasts in the slow cooker. Add the chicken broth, carrots, celery, onion, garlic, thyme, salt, and pepper. Stir in the cream of chicken soup and milk.
- Cover and cook on low for 6-7 hours, or until the ch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Once cooked, shred the chicken in the slow cooker and mix well with the broth and vegetables.
- In a separate bowl, combine the biscuit mix and 2/3 cup milk. Stir until just combined.
- Drop spoonfuls of the dumpling mixture on top of the chicken mixture in the slow cooker. Cover and cook on high for an additional 30 minutes, or until the dumplings are cooked through.
- Serve hot and enjoy your delicious Slow Cooker Chicken and Dumplings!
Lemon Herb Chicken Soup

Lemon Herb Chicken Soup is a bright and refreshing take on the classic comfort dish. The vibrant flavors of fresh herbs and lemon uplift the savory notes of tender chicken, making each spoonful a delightful experience. This recipe is simple to follow, perfect for both novice cooks and seasoned chefs looking for a quick and satisfying meal.
The combination of lemon and herbs not only enhances the taste but also adds a layer of wellness, making it a go-to for cozy evenings or when you need a little pick-me-up. With just a few ingredients, you can whip up this nourishing soup in no time!
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h thyme, chopped
- 1 lemon, juiced and zested
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chopped onion, carrots, and celery. Sauté until the vegetables are softened, about 5 minutes.
-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.
- Pour in the chicken broth and bring to a simmer. Add the shredded chicken, fresh parsley, thyme, lemon juice, and zest.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ste. Let the soup simmer for about 15-20 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
- Serve warm, garnished with additional parsley or lemon slices if desired.
Coconut Curry Chicken Soup

Coconut Curry Chicken Soup brings together the warmth of comforting chicken soup with the vibrant flavors of coconut and curry. This dish is perfect for those chilly evenings when you’re craving something hearty yet light. With its creamy coconut milk base and a blend of spices, it offers a delightful taste that will warm you from the inside out.
This recipe is simple to make, requiring just a few ingredients and minimal prep time. You can easily adjust the spice levels to suit your taste, making it a flexible and satisfying option for any night of the week.
Ingredients
- 1 pound boneless chicken thighs, diced
- 1 can (14 ounces) coconut milk
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 tablespoons red curry paste
- 2 cups mixed vegetables (like carrots, bell peppers, and potatoes)
- 1 tablespoon fish sauce
- 1 tablespoon lime juice
- Fresh cilantro, for garnish
- Sal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ions
- In a large pot over medium heat, add the diced chicken and cook until browned, about 5-7 minutes.
- Stir in the red curry paste and cook for another minute until fragrant.
- Add the mixed vegetables, chicken broth, and coconut milk. Bring to a simmer.
- Let the soup cook for about 15-20 minutes until the vegetables are tender and the chicken is cooked through.
- Stir in the fish sauce and lime juice.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ro.
Ginger Garlic Chicken Soup

This Ginger Garlic Chicken Soup is a comforting bowl of warmth, perfect for chilly days. The aromatic blend of ginger and garlic adds a zesty kick, while tender pieces of chicken make it satisfying and nourishing.
Simple to prepare, this soup is an excellent choice for a quick weeknight meal or a healthy lunch. With its delightful flavors and healing properties, it’s sure to become a favorite in your household.
Ingredients
- 1 pound chicken breast or thighs
- 8 cups chicken broth
- 2 tablespoons fresh ginger, sliced
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 1 cup carrots, sliced
- 1 cup celery, chopped
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h cilantro for garnish
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at a little o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onions, carrots, and celery, sautéing until softened.
- Stir in the minced garlic and sliced ginger, cooking for an additional minute until fragrant.
- Add the chicken and pour in the chicken broth. Bring to a boil, then lower the heat and let it simmer for about 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.
- Remove the chicken, shred it with two forks, and return it to the pot. Stir in soy sauce, and season with salt and pepper.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ro.
Rustic Chicken Vegetable Soup

This Rustic Chicken Vegetable Soup is a warm hug in a bowl. Packed with tender chicken and vibrant vegetables, it’s both hearty and nourishing. The simplicity of the recipe makes it perfect for weeknight dinners or comforting meals on chilly days.
The combination of fresh herbs, wholesome ingredients, and slow-cooked flavors creates a delicious aroma that fills your kitchen. Plus, it’s easy to make and can be customized with your favorite vegetables!
Ingredients
- 1 whole chicken (about 4-5 lbs)
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 3 large carrots, sliced
- 3 celery stalks, chopped
- 1 onion, diced
- 4-5 small potatoes, quartered
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 bay leaf
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Instructions
- In a large pot, add the whole chicken and cover with chicken broth. Bring to a simmer over medium heat.
- Add the sliced carrots, chopped celery, diced onion, quartered potatoes, minced garlic, dried thyme, bay leaf, salt, and pepper.
- Cover and let it simmer for about 1.5 to 2 hours or until the ch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Once cooked, remove the chicken and let it cool slightly. Shred the meat and discard the skin and bones.
- Return the shredded chicken to the pot.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Remove the bay leaf before serving.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.
Asian-Inspired Chicken Wonton Soup

This Asian-inspired chicken wonton soup is a warm, comforting bowl that packs a punch of flavor. With tender chicken and delightful wontons swimming in a savory broth, it’s a dish that’s both satisfying and delicious. Plus, it’s surprisingly simple to make, making it perfect for a weeknight dinner or a cozy weekend lunch.
The combination of fresh ingredients, such as green onions and ginger, adds layers of taste, while the wontons provide a delightful texture. It’s light yet hearty, making it a go-to for any soup lover!
Ingredients
- 8 oz ground chicken
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il
- 1 teaspoon minced ginger
- 1 teaspoon minced garlic
- 1 package wonton wrappers
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ups water
- 1 cup chopped green onions
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Prepare the Wontons: In a bowl, mix the ground chicken, soy sauce, sesame oil, ginger, and garlic until well combined. Place a small spoonful of the mixture in the center of each wonton wrapper. Moisten the edges with water, fold, and seal them tightly.
- Cook the Broth: In a large pot, combine chicken broth and water.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er.
- Add the Wontons: Gently drop the prepared wontons into the simmering broth. Cook for about 5-7 minutes or until the wontons float and are cooked through.
- Finish: Add chopped green onions and season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ot and enjoy your delicious bowl of chicken wonton soup!
